GNU LilyPond

GNU LilyPond is a free software music typesetting[?] package. It uses a simple ASCII notation for music, which is then compiled into TeX with embedded PostScript. The PostScript output can then be used to produce printable files or images.

It is anticipated that GNU LilyPond support will be added to Wikipedia in the future, to allow inline generation of musical scores and other musical notation within Wikipedia.
